## Service Accounts — StormFan Alert Fan-Out

The fan-out worker authenticates to the internal dispatch tier using the svc-stormfan account. Rotate quarterly; scopes are limited to publish-only on alert topics. If deliveries stall during your shift, verify the worker is using the current credential, reproduced below for reference.

API key for kaweg-hahif: kto4_rAjZ

TURN-208: Gatevale turnstile counters at the Merrow Field pilot double-count when a rotation reverses mid-cycle. Attendance totals drift roughly 2% high per event. The debounce window fix is implemented, reviewed by Ilsa, and soak-tested across two simulated match days without drift. Ready for your cut; the candidate build is identified below.

trace token, tagag-tafog: htk6_5ed18c

Restricted Wiki Page (Managers Only) – Vantrel Goods

Currency Hedging Decision

Following volatility in the crown-to-mark rate, leadership has approved forward contracts covering roughly sixty percent of expected export receipts from the Ostbury region for the next two quarters. Sales leads should quote in local currency as usual; finance absorbs the hedge cost centrally. Margins on the Ferriway line are unaffected. Review the pricing FAQ before client calls. The confidential planning note follows below.

internal memo for faweg-tafog: Only 7 of the 100 pilot accounts renewed Quenael, so a churn review is set for April 15.